WebJun 24, 2024 · Florida provides, that a Defendant has 20 days after receiving service of a complaint to file an answer, or 60 days if service has been waived. When a party fails to respond within the statutory timeline, the petitioner may seek an entry of default. The Florida Rules of Civil Procedure, Rule 1.500 governs the process and requirements of Defaults.

WebNov 28, 2007 · Under Rule 55 (b) (1) the plaintiff must request the clerk to enter the judgment by default and submit affidavits establishing the amount due and stating that the defendant is not an infant or an adjudged incompetent person. The section is also affected by the Soldiers' and Sailors' Civil Relief Act, 50 U.S.C.App. § 520, which is discussed below.
